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between Sierra Leone and Guinea. To live, work, or study long-term in Guinea,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Guinea's immigration authority.

Sierra Leone passport

Sierra Leone passport holder visiting Guinea

Visa Free
Sierra Leone passport holders can enter Guinea without a visa.
Guinea passport

Guinea passport holder visiting Sierra Leone

Visa Free
Guinea passport holders can enter Sierra Leone without a visa.

What's the weather like in Guinea compared to Sierra Leone?

The average high temperature in Conakry is 88°F, compared to 86°F in Freetown. Conakry receives around 146.9 in of rainfall per year, while Freetown gets 116.0 in.

What language do they speak in Guinea?

The official language in Guinea is French. In Sierra Leone, the official language is English.
